Chips
The transponder chip is one that is found in most car keys today. When you insert your key into the ignition lock and turn it to ON, the antenna transmits the radio frequency signal to the transponder along with the identification code. The chip then sends a flash of energy back to the ignition lock, which it utilizes to determine whether the key is able to start the vehicle.
If the vehicle is configured to only accept a certain kind of chip, it won't start using a non-transponder keys. This is a method for stopping car theft since the only person who can start your car with an unrecoverable key is the original owner. Whether you're a professional locksmith or auto repair technician Key fob programming tools can offer convenience as well as cost savings and peace of mind for your customers. These tools are typically bidirectional OBD-II units that connect to the vehicle's computer and then extract the programming information. These tools can be used to program a variety of vehicle models and brands. Some even have additional diagnostic functions.
The most frequent use of key programmers is to duplicate a functioning car key. Connect the device to the key that is working and then place it in the ignition and turn the key until the security light blinks. This will activate the key and make it work like the original.
When using a key programmer there are a few things you should be aware of. It is important to be aware that if don't follow the directions correctly you could harm the immobilizer system of your vehicle. In addition, you should make sure that the tool you use to program is compatible with your vehicle and the specific immobilizer system.
